The Historical Symbolism of Ships
Ships as Ancient Symbols
Ships have symbolized life’s journey for thousands of years. Ancient civilizations depended on ships for trade, exploration, and survival.
Because of this connection, ships became symbols of destiny, adventure, and human progress. A successful voyage represented achievement, while a shipwreck often symbolized failure or unexpected change.
Pre-Christian and Mythological Roots
In many ancient cultures, water represented the unknown. Crossing oceans often symbolized entering new stages of life.
Mythological stories frequently featured dangerous sea journeys:
• Heroes crossing mysterious waters.
• Transformation through hardship.
• Survival after divine tests.
• Rebirth after destruction.
• Discovery following great challenges.
These themes continue to influence dream interpretation today.

How the Meaning Has Changed Over Time
Older Interpretations
Historically, shipwreck dreams were often viewed as warnings about danger or misfortune.
This reflected the real risks associated with sea travel.
Modern Interpretations
Today, many dream analysts focus more on psychological and emotional themes.
Current interpretations often emphasize:
• Adaptability.
• Personal growth.
• Emotional recovery.
• Transformation.
• New beginnings.
The meaning has gradually shifted from fear toward empowerment.
